ZZ Amplification Using A Fluxonium Coupler With A Large ON/OFF Ratio
A system and method provide a configurable quantum logic gate. The system includes two fixed-frequency transmon qubits that are capacitively coupled to each other and to a tunable fluxonium coupler. Applying a magnetic flux to the coupler results in a controlled decrease in the ZZ interaction between the two transmon qubits. When the two transmon qubits have a small, positive ZZ interaction without any field present, applying a particular flux to the coupler effectively eliminates the interaction. Applying a larger flux produces a large, negative ZZ interaction that results in an avoided level crossing at an operational frequency. Appropriate choice of the applied flux permits implementation of, among other things, an adiabatic controlled Z (CZ) gate having high fidelity and low complexity.
